Please type at least 3 characters

Senior Front-end Developer

build a new application to interface with Aragon’s smart contracts

type of job

full-time

updated at

16 months ago

job details

role overview

As a Senior Front-end Developer at Aragon, you will join our App squad to build a new application to interface with Aragon’s smart contracts - those that will be used for creating and managing the next generation of digital organizations.

responsibilities

  • Translate user needs into production-ready code.
  • Be involved across the discovery and development pipeline, from collaborating with UX/UI designers and creating prototypes to implementation, documentation and guides, deployment, and live maintenance.
  • Take ownership of Aragon front-end development, establish best practices, and become the “go-to” point of contact, while simultaneously mentoring more junior developers along the way.
  • Coordinate across our various squads, improve the quality of our commits.
  • Use code reviews to better understand your team’s work, improve the quality of our commits, and learn something along the way. 
  • Have a good eye for high-quality graphic implementations, and let the team know if we need to be “pixel perfect”

requirements

  • Proven ability to deliver software to real users as a front-end developer, ideally in a fast-paced startup environment
  • 3+ years experience in one or more general purpose programming languages such as JS/TS
  • Extensive knowledge about the internals of JavaScript engines, browsers and how to work with React.sj and other well-known JavaScript frameworks
  • Awareness of basic design principles, including layouts, aesthetics, and how to work with a UX team
  • Experience implementing web applications according SEO best practices
  • Able to advocate and enforce best practices on the team, including testing (unit, integration, e2e), clean code principles, documentation, etc.
  • Experience working in agile environment, git flows, and are comfortable in the tools (e.g. Jira, Github)
  • Excellent English communication - both written and oral - that is completely free of bullshit

Bonus skills:

  • Understanding of of Blockchain architecture, in particular Ethereum
  • Experience working on open source projects, ideally in blockchain, cryptography, smart contracts, decentralized systems, or any related technology in the web3 ecosystem
  • Experience with the other skills needed to be successful with our tech stack (Ethereum/EVM, HardHat/TypeChain, GraphQL/Subgraph, etc.)
  • Passionate about the possibilities of decentralized autonomous organizations and the impacts they may have on how humans work together to solve problems
  • Competitive degen score

culture & perks

We value freedom and responsibility - so much so that we are in the process of taking this one step further with our plans to fully transition into our DAO by 2023. This means that we're a remote only organisation that's flexible as to where you want to work and your schedule, as long as you're within +/- 5 hours of UTC. We will trust you to accommodate to best support your team.

You will get all of the resources needed to be effective, whether its for setting up your remote work environment or a personal development budget.

about us

Aragon Association is a small, remote-only and humble team of people that span a broad range of backgrounds, interests, and geographies. We're entrepreneurs and Ph.D.s, craft beer and coffee lovers, living across the US, EU, Asia and everywhere in between who are designing and building unstoppable governance tools for decentralized organizations.

Aragon Association has overseen the production of the leading smart contract framework to build DAOs, with toolkits for developers to seamlessly integrate their apps with DAO functionality, and a decentralized dispute resolution system. The Aragon Association is an Equal Opportunity Employer, and the steward of the Aragon project, a community of DAO creators, developers, and users experimenting with new forms of social coordination and governance.

organization

open page
Aragon
Aragon
details
Aragon's open source platform governance plugins enable users to build and manage DAOs